Make sure the jumper on your drive is set correctly. If you are using only the one drive, set it for Cable Select, and make sure it is on the far end of the IDE cable.

Cable Select doesn't always work on some motherboards and some drives. If that happens, set the jumper for Master, and the system should recognize it regardless of which connector you use on the IDE cable.

Another conflict can arise if you have your CD-ROM on the same IDE channel. It is better to have it on the other IDE channel, but if they have to share the same channel, make sure the jumper on the CD-ROM is also set to Cable Select, if that is what you did with the HD, or set it as Slave if you set the HD as Master.
